I designed this bra after determining a need for a unique racerback design that accounted for the potential fit discomfort associated with traditional racerbacks that cut through the shoulder blade. This design was selected for production with Ajani's next collection. The first production samples are shown here, along with the technical flats I rendered as part of the tech pack. I developed three colorways based on target market research. The goal was to appeal to a new women's market.

Circular Remanufacturing

I gathered end-of-use garments and created an updated design with the collected garments. I designed a split print button-down shirt using two end-of-use cotton shirts that were being discarded due to staining. 

​

Because this project was about remanufacturing, each design choice had to be made within the parameters of what a brand could reasonably reproduce if it were to be scaled up. Thus, I made very minimal design updates to keep the product marketable/in circulation without costing the "brand" additional time, money, or labor.
